Most Effective Earplugs for Sleeping Soundly
Finding peaceful slumber can be a struggle when external noises disrupt your sleep. Luckily, there are numerous earplug options available to help you achieve that much-needed rest.
To find the best solution for you, it's important to consider your personal needs and preferences. Some people prefer earplugs made from soft materials like silicone or foam, while others find that firmer earplugs provide a better seal.
It's also important to think about the intensity of noise you need to reduce. For example, here if you live in a noisy environment, you may need earplugs that offer a higher decibel rating.
Ultimately, the best-performing earplugs for sleeping soundly are those that feel fitting and effectively isolate noise to create a peaceful and serene sleep environment.

Best Earplugs for Dentists: Comfort and Protection
Dentists are exposed to high levels of noise daily. This constant exertion can lead to hearing loss over time, making it crucial for dentists to protect their hearing. Selecting the right earplugs is essential to ensure both comfort and effective noise suppression.
Ideally, dental earplugs should be gentle to wear for extended periods, as dentists often need them throughout their workday. They should also provide a good amount of auditory reduction without muffling important sounds, like patient communication or dental instruments.
Look for earplugs made from comfortable materials like silicone or foam.
Research different types of earplugs, such as custom-molded plugs for a personalized fit or pre-shaped plugs that are simple to insert and remove.
When picking earplugs, focus on both comfort and noise reduction capabilities to ensure optimal hearing protection and general well-being.
